Arizona State University (ASU), a beacon of innovation and a leading public research institution, has consistently redefined the landscape of higher education. Founded in 1885, ASU has grown from its humble beginnings into a global powerhouse, attracting students from over 150 countries to its multiple campuses across Arizona, including Tempe, Downtown Phoenix, Polytechnic, and West. With a commitment to both online and on-campus excellence, ASU is committed to shaping the future. The university's commitment to accessibility is evident in its tuition rates, which rank among the lowest in the Big 12, further enhanced by scholarships and financial aid packages. Whether you're seeking an undergraduate degree, a graduate certificate, or a doctoral program, ASU offers more than 800 accredited degree programs across diverse fields and learning environments.
